Hi, I need to do something like this:
a=[1 2 3 4 5 6 7 8 9 10];
for i=1:lenght(a)
for ii=i-2:i+2
x=a(ii);
end
end

I need to do the iteration only in the range +- 2 of i.The problem is that a(-1) ,a(0),a(11) and a(12) doesn't exist . . Is there any simple way to solve that problem without using the if conditions?

Best Answer

a = 1:10;
n = numel(a);
for kk = 1:n
for ii = max(1,kk-2):min(n,kk+2)
x = a(ii);
end
end
